Oenology - anthocyanin structures
Hi everyone,
I'm currently translating a wine tasting guide written from a very in-depth oenological perspective for my MA dissertation and am completely at a loss to find the meaning of and correct equivalent for 'meticulacion' in this sentence. The context immediately prior to this involves images (which really must be viewed in order to understand the full context of the question - please see the URL below) of anthocyanin ring structures and discusses possible occurrences within them such as glycosidation and acylation.
Please use this URL to access the document as it will clarify the context. The sentence with which I am having problems is at the top of page 20, and the related images of anthocyanin structures are just above it on page 19:
http://www.conocimientoytecnologia.org/portales_tematicos/po...
I would be extremely grateful if anyone with knowledge of (oenological) chemical compounds could help me with this sentence, as I suspect there is more meaning behind it than I can hope to grasp without a more comprehensive knowledge of phenolic compounds and processes and have been utterly unable to find any enlightment for 'meticulacion' through online research. I am reluctant simply to stick in something simplistic such as 'meticulation of [the] hydroxyls in this ring' as it smacks of the need for explication. I explored the possibility of a 'methy-' stem but again have had little luck.

methylation of the hydroxyl group pertaining to this ring
While the origin of hydroxy groups in positions 3' , 4' and ... 1988), and there is good evidence that methylation of A- and B-ring hydroxyl groups are late ...
